Moople Institute of Animation and Design, Midnapore admissions are made on the basis academic merit and creative aptitude of the students. Students wishing to seek admission to the courses provided by the institute need to qualify for the eligibility criteria specified for each course. Moople Institute of Animation and Design, Midnapore UG admission requires students to pass Class 12 or equivalent from a recognised board. For certain courses, those with UG/ PG degrees may also apply. Further, for some certificate courses, Class 10 marks are also accepted.

Moople Institute of Animation and Design eligibility criteria varies for the two BSc specialisations. The specialisation-wise eligibility is presented here:
- BSc Animation Film Making: Class 12 with a minimum aggregate of 50%
- BSc VFX Film Making: Class 10 with a minimum aggregate of 50%

Footwear Design and Development Institute, Patna specifies the minimum qualification and aggregate to apply for a course. Aspirants must fulfil the eligibility requirements to fill out the application form. Below is course-wise eligibility for FDDI Patna:
| Course | Common Eligibility |
|---|---|
| BDes | Class 12 in any stream from a recognised board The age limit for the Bachelor's programme shall be 25 years as on July 1 of the admission year |
| BBA | Class 12 in any stream from a recognised board The age limit for the Bachelor's programme shall be 25 years as on July 1 of the admission year |
| MBA | Bachelor's degree in any discipline No age limit |
